About
Influential advocate and fundraiser in Democratic politics. Tech and telecom attorney who served for the Senate Commerce Committee. Thrives in critical situations that require a rapid response.
Al Mottur is a senior Democratic strategist who solves the most complex and thorny political issues clients face in Washington, D.C. He connects organizations with leaders at the highest levels of Democratic politics, in both Congress and the Biden administration, and uses his legal and policy intellect to build consensus around solutions. When Fortune 50 corporations or sovereign governments face a major crisis, Al is often the person they turn to. He is at his best in high-pressure, high-stakes scenarios. Al has successfully protected high-profile mergers and acquisitions, defended companies from contentious oversight battles, and delivered legislative victories that saved clients billions of dollars.
As co-chair of the firm’s technology and telecommunication practice, Al engages federal policymakers as they develop legislation and regulations to address emerging technologies, data privacy, Big Tech, competition law and infrastructure. He has strong relationships with political and career officials at the Department of Commerce, FTC and FCC, as well as with Democratic leadership in Congress, including senior members of the House and Senate commerce committees. Al formerly served as senior communications counsel for the Senate Commerce, Science and Transportation Committee.
In addition to his advocacy, Al is a prolific fundraiser for the Democratic Party. He spearheaded the firm’s bundling efforts during the last presidential election, raising more money for the DNC than any other D.C. lobbying firm.
